Carnatic music is not as globally famous as Hindustani music, but that doesn’t mean it’s less rich or important. The primary reasons for this difference in recognition are historical influences, accessibility, and exposure. 1. Historical & Geographical Reasons Hindustani music had royal patronage from Mughals & North Indian courts, making it more visible. Carnatic music remained within South Indian temples & local courts, limiting its reach. The British colonial influence promoted Hindustani music more, especially in Western education systems. 2.
